Municipal Government - As enacted, creates a process for continuing funding for a municipal LEA when the municipal legislative body and the governing body for the LEA cannot agree on a budget; provides a process for continuing funding of municipal operations when a municipal legislative body has not adopted a budget by the first day of a fiscal year. - Amends TCA Title 6, Chapter 56, Part 1 and Title 6, Chapter 56, Part 2.
SB 1592 creates automatic processes to prevent budget deadlocks affecting Tennessee municipalities and their local school districts (LEAs). If a city council and school board fail to agree on a school budget by August 31, the LEA receives minimum state-mandated school funding - plus a 3% mandatory increase after three consecutive years of disagreement. For general municipal operations, if a city council misses the fiscal year budget deadline, the previous year’s budget continues with strict spending limits (capped at prior-year monthly allotments) until a new budget is adopted, extendable only for up to three months with state comptroller approval. The bill directly affects all Tennessee cities with school districts and their governing bodies, ensuring basic services continue during budget disputes.
